Hey Guys,
I'm new to the forum, and as you're about to find out, not technically adept in any way. I have a few boogie amps - Road King 2, Mark 5 and TA-15. Only the TA-15 does any travelling. The others are studio amps. I've been mostly using my Mark 5 for the past few months and today decided to switch it out for the road king 2, but there's a problem with the footswitch. As far as I know it hasn't been banged up at all, and it worked a few months ago, but now it will not select channels on the amp - the back panel is set for footswitch, and when I toggle it the channels will change normally. I tried the mark 5 footswitch with the same cord, and it will toggle channels 1-3, but if I use the roadking switch, the four channel lights stay lit, and I'm unable to toggle channels. All the hard-switch buttons work (reverb, fx, solo) but none of the soft-touch channel buttons. I can hear a faint click through the amp when I try to select channel 3, but that's it.
Any ideas how to fix? I live in NB Canada, and there are no mesa techs within a thousand miles. I'd just order a new footswitch, but you can't order direct to Canada.
